"Effective Strategies for Data Migration in Salesforce"
Best Practices for Planning a Successful Data Migration in Salesforce
In today's digital age, businesses rely heavily on data to make informed decisions and provide personalized experiences to their customers. Salesforce, being one of the leading Customer Relationship Management (CRM) platforms, plays a vital role in managing and organizing this data. However, migrating data into Salesforce can be a complex process that requires careful planning and execution. In this article, we will explore effective strategies for data migration in Salesforce, ensuring a smooth transition and accurate data representation.
Understanding Data Migration
Data migration refers to the process of transferring data from one system or platform to another. In the context of Salesforce, data migration involves moving data from legacy systems, spreadsheets, or other CRM platforms into Salesforce. It is a critical step in ensuring that accurate and up-to-date data is available for effective sales, marketing, and customer service activities.
Preparing for Data Migration
Before initiating the data migration process, thorough preparation is essential. The following steps should be taken:
Assessing Data Quality and Cleanup
Start by evaluating the quality of your existing data. Identify and rectify any inconsistencies, duplications, or errors. Cleaning up the data ensures that only relevant and accurate information is migrated to Salesforce.
Defining Migration Goals and Scope
Clearly define your migration goals and scope. Determine which data objects, fields, and records need to be migrated. This step helps in setting priorities and streamlining the migration process.
Establishing Data Ownership and Governance
Assign data ownership to respective stakeholders and establish data governance policies. Clear ownership ensures accountability and facilitates efficient data management throughout the migration process and beyond.
Choosing the Right Data Migration Method
Salesforce offers various methods for data migration. Consider the following options based on your specific requirements:
Manual Data Entry
Manual data entry involves manually inputting data into Salesforce. While it is suitable for small datasets, it can be time-consuming and error-prone for large volumes of data.
Import and Export Tools
Salesforce provides import and export tools, such as the Data Import Wizard and Data Export Wizard. These tools enable you to import data from external sources or export data from Salesforce for backup or analysis purposes.
Data Loader
Data Loader is a powerful Salesforce tool that allows bulk data imports and exports. It provides a command-line interface and supports various file formats, making it suitable for complex data migration scenarios.
Integration Tools
Integration tools like Salesforce Connect and Salesforce Integration Cloud enable seamless data integration between Salesforce and other applications or databases. These tools are useful when you need real-time data synchronization or integration with external systems.
Third-Party Data Migration Solutions
Third-party data migration solutions offer advanced features and automation capabilities for complex data migration projects. These solutions provide a user-friendly interface, pre-built templates, and data mapping tools, simplifying the migration process.
Mapping and Transforming Data
Data mapping and transformation are crucial steps in data migration.
Data Mapping
Data mapping involves establishing relationships between source and target fields in Salesforce. It ensures that data is correctly aligned during migration, maintaining data integrity.
Data Transformation
Data transformation involves modifying or reformatting data to meet Salesforce's requirements. It may include data cleansing, standardization, and data enrichment to enhance data quality.
Testing and Validation
Thorough testing and validation are necessary to ensure a successful data migration.
Sample Data Testing
Before migrating the entire dataset, perform sample data testing. Validate the accuracy and completeness of the migrated data to identify any issues or discrepancies.
Full Data Testing
Once the sample data testing is successful, proceed with full data testing. Test the migration process with a larger dataset to uncover any potential problems or performance issues.
Data Validation and Quality Checks
Validate the migrated data against predefined business rules and perform quality checks. Ensure that data is consistent, error-free, and meets your organization's standards.
Data Migration Execution
Execute the data migration process using the chosen method.
Data Backup
Before initiating the migration, take a complete backup of the existing data. This backup serves as a safety net in case any issues arise during the migration process.
Data Migration Plan
Create a detailed data migration plan that outlines the sequence of migration activities, dependencies, and estimated timeframes. A well-defined plan helps in coordinating the migration process effectively.
Data Migration Schedule
Determine an appropriate time window for data migration to minimize disruptions to daily operations. Communicate the migration schedule to stakeholders and ensure their availability for support if required.
Post-Migration Activities
After completing the data migration, certain post-migration activities are crucial.
Data Verification
Validate the migrated data in Salesforce against the source data to ensure accuracy and completeness. Compare key metrics and perform data reconciliation if necessary.
User Training and Adoption
Train end-users on Salesforce and the newly migrated data. Provide comprehensive training to ensure that users understand the data structure, data entry guidelines, and reporting capabilities.
Data Governance and Maintenance
Establish data governance practices to maintain data quality, security, and compliance. Regularly monitor data integrity, perform periodic data audits, and implement processes for data maintenance and updates.
Monitoring and Troubleshooting
Continuous monitoring and proactive troubleshooting are essential for a successful data migration.
Monitoring Data Migration Process
Monitor the data migration process in real time. Keep track of data volumes, migration speed, and any errors or exceptions encountered. This monitoring helps in identifying potential bottlenecks or issues.
Addressing Data Integrity Issues
If data integrity issues arise during or after migration, promptly address them. Investigate the root cause, identify corrective actions, and implement necessary changes to maintain data integrity.
Handling Data Migration Failures
In case of data migration failures, have a contingency plan in place. Analyze the failure reasons, reattempt the migration with necessary fixes, or seek assistance from experts or Salesforce support.
Conclusion
Effective data migration is crucial for businesses leveraging Salesforce to harness the power of data. By following the strategies outlined in this article, you can ensure a smooth and successful data migration process. Remember to plan thoroughly, choose the right migration method, map and transform data accurately, test rigorously, and perform post-migration activities to maintain data quality and user adoption.
Frequently Asked Questions (FAQs)
Q1: Can I migrate data from multiple sources into Salesforce simultaneously?
Yes, Salesforce supports data migration from multiple sources simultaneously. Depending on the chosen method, you can import data from various databases, spreadsheets, or legacy systems concurrently.
Q2: How long does the data migration process take?
The duration of the data migration process varies based on factors such as data volume, complexity, chosen migration method, and available resources. It is advisable to create a realistic timeline based on your specific requirements and allocate sufficient time for testing and validation.
Q3: What happens to the existing data in Salesforce during migration?
Existing data in Salesforce is not automatically overwritten during migration. However, you need to map and transform the data accurately to ensure its alignment with the existing records and fields.
Q4: Can I migrate historical data into Salesforce?
Yes, you can migrate historical data into Salesforce. Ensure that the data is cleaned, transformed, and mapped correctly to maintain its accuracy and relevance.
Q5: Do I need professional assistance for data migration in Salesforce?
While some businesses can manage the data migration process internally, professional assistance can be beneficial, especially for complex migration scenarios. Salesforce experts or third-party consultants can provide guidance, expertise, and ensure a smooth migration experience.